手机空号检测接口对接全流程指南

一、什么是手机空号检测接口?

在短信通知、电话营销、注册验证、金融风控等场景中,一个关键问题是:手机号是否真实在用?

如果号码为空号、停机号、沉默号或高风险号,将导致短信投递失败、通信成本浪费、甚至影响企业信誉。

手机空号检测接口是一种通过 API 实时检测手机号状态的服务,可识别手机号是否为实号、空号、停机号、沉默号或风险号,帮助企业精准过滤无效号码。

空号检测核心应用场景

短信/语音服务商:群发前剔除无效号码,提升送达率;

金融/互联网平台:注册时验证手机号可用性;

营销运营:过滤沉默号,提升投放转化;

风控与反欺诈系统:识别高风险号码,减少异常注册。

二、手机空号检测接口调用全流程

1.申请接口权限

在新诺韦尔科技这样的API接口平台注册开发者账号,申请接口服务,获取 appId 和 appKey,并将服务器 IP 加入白名单。

2.确认接口信息

接口地址(支持 GET 和 POST 方式):http://api2.lfv2.cn/v1/mobile/empty

3.准备请求参数

在请求头中包含 appId、timestamp、sign;

在请求体或 URL 参数中传入 mobile(待检测手机号)。

4.生成签名 sign

使用 sha256(appId + timestamp + appKey) 算法生成安全签名。

5.发送 HTTP 请求

将构造好的参数发送至接口端点,获取 JSON 格式返回数据。

6.解析结果与处理逻辑

根据 data.status 值判断手机号状态,决定是否计费、过滤或继续使用。

7.异常与重试机制

捕获错误码,针对超时、签名错误、余额不足等情况进行重试或报警。

8.监控调用统计

定期记录调用量、成功率、空号比例等指标,优化号码库质量与接口策略。

三、空号检测接口参数说明

提示:

timestamp 与服务器时间差建议不超过 5 分钟;

单次请求检测 1 个号码;

批量检测建议采用异步队列或定时任务,避免触发限流。

四、手机空号查询接口签名算法详解

空号接口签名用于身份验证与防伪造。

签名生成规则如下:

sign = sha256(appId + timestamp + appKey)

1.参数说明:

appId :服务商提供的应用标识;

timestamp :当前时间(毫秒级);

appKey :服务商分配的密钥;

sha256 :标准 SHA-256 哈希算法。

2.示例:

appId = "abc123"

timestamp = "1682476912345"

appKey = "secretKey"

签名字符串 = "abc1231682476912345secretKey"

sign = sha256(签名字符串)

3.注意事项:

拼接顺序必须一致(appId → timestamp → appKey);

每次请求必须生成新的 timestamp 与 sign;

sign 结果区分大小写;

若签名不匹配将返回 code = 4(签名错误)。

五、手机空号接口返回结果说明

1.成功示例:

{

"code": "0",

"message": "成功",

"isCharge": 1,

"orderNo": "nwks3bjtd98weefw13epvltpv71iqaqf",

"data": {

"area": "广东-广州",

"channel": "中国移动",

"status": 4

}

}

2.错误示例:

{

"code": "1",

"message": "请输入有效的手机号",

"isCharge": 0,

"data": null

}

3.字段说明:

4.状态码解释:

六、空号查询接口错误码与排查建议

七、手机空号检测接口示例代码

小结:

手机空号检测接口是企业在数据清洗、用户验证、短信营销和风险防控中的关键基础能力。通过实时判断手机号是否为实号、空号、停机号或风险号,企业能够显著提升数据质量,降低通信成本,并在注册、登录、支付、风控等环节构建更高效的安全防线。

在实施过程中,开发者应重点关注签名安全、接口稳定性与调用频率控制。建议将接口调用流程封装为可复用模块或 SDK,实现自动生成签名、请求重试、异常处理与日志监控,确保大规模调用的稳定性和追踪性。同时,合理设置并发量与限流策略,避免接口被封禁或误判为异常流量。

此外,空号检测接口应与其他手机号验证能力(如手机三要素接口、手机在网时长接口、身份证实名接口)配合使用,形成完整的号码真伪核验链路。在确保数据安全与合法合规的前提下,这类接口能够帮助企业实现从号码有效性筛查 → 用户精准触达 → 风控预警优化的全流程提升,为营销与安全体系带来更可量化的价值。

相关推荐
武子康10 小时前
大数据-237 离线数仓 - Hive 广告业务实战:ODS→DWD 事件解析、广告明细与转化分析落地
大数据·后端·apache hive
大大大大晴天11 小时前
Flink生产问题排障-Kryo serializer scala extensions are not available
大数据·flink
武子康2 天前
大数据-236 离线数仓 - 会员指标验证、DataX 导出与广告业务 ODS/DWD/ADS 全流程
大数据·后端·apache hive
用户60648767188963 天前
国内开发者如何接入 Claude API?中转站方案实战指南(Python/Node.js 完整示例)
人工智能·python·api
武子康3 天前
大数据-235 离线数仓 - 实战:Flume+HDFS+Hive 搭建 ODS/DWD/DWS/ADS 会员分析链路
大数据·后端·apache hive
DianSan_ERP4 天前
电商API接口全链路监控:构建坚不可摧的线上运维防线
大数据·运维·网络·人工智能·git·servlet
够快云库4 天前
能源行业非结构化数据治理实战:从数据沼泽到智能资产
大数据·人工智能·机器学习·企业文件安全
AI周红伟4 天前
周红伟:智能体全栈构建实操:OpenClaw部署+Agent Skills+Seedance+RAG从入门到实战
大数据·人工智能·大模型·智能体
呉師傅4 天前
火狐浏览器报错配置文件缺失如何解决#操作技巧#
运维·网络·windows·电脑
B站计算机毕业设计超人4 天前
计算机毕业设计Django+Vue.js高考推荐系统 高考可视化 大数据毕业设计(源码+LW文档+PPT+详细讲解)
大数据·vue.js·hadoop·django·毕业设计·课程设计·推荐算法